Javascript-форум (https://javascript.ru/forum/)
-   Node.JS (https://javascript.ru/forum/node-js-io-js/)
-   -   Загрузка файлов DLL (https://javascript.ru/forum/node-js-io-js/84278-zagruzka-fajjlov-dll.html)

Node_noob 28.07.2022 00:30

Загрузка файлов DLL
 
А возможно в ноде загрузить какую нибудь DLL, и использовать её методы?

ksa 28.07.2022 08:14

Вроде модуль node-ffi-napi с этим работает...
https://www.npmjs.com/package/ffi-napi

Node_noob 28.07.2022 14:23

Спасибо, а сами не использовали?

ksa 28.07.2022 18:50

Хватает пока модулей...

MallSerg 29.07.2022 05:16

>> А возможно в ноде загрузить какую нибудь DLL, и использовать её методы?

Это возможно но как правило не имеет смысла.
JavaScript это интерпретатор со сборщиком мусора по этому код JS не может работать с данными вне объектной модели которую создает интерпретатор JS в любом случае загруженная DLL должна будет обращаться к интерпретатору JS с помощью API для создания размещения и изменения данных и в любом случае это будут массивы байтов или потоки байтов. А с IO потоками nodeJS и без всяких DLL умеет работать. По этому с помощью IO потоков и строиться всякая коммутация nodeJS


Часовой пояс GMT +3, время: 03:44.